Most space technologies are dual-use in the sense that they can do both things. If you put a platform in space to observe for environmental and natural disaster purposes, it could probably detect heat. Infrared technology in space can also see what's happening on the ground. If you look at the utilization of our current satellite, the RADARSAT Constellation Mission, 50% of the data goes to the Department of National Defence, and that's always been the case. It makes sense as a country that if we have that capacity, we use it for all of our needs and for security purposes as well.

We remain a civil space agency. On the other hand, we are also happy to help grow a Canadian space sector that can then meet the moment. If there is a need to invest in security in the north and in the Arctic, there are also a number of space applications that can help with what we want to do in that regard.

I also mentioned how space has become increasingly populated. Land, sea and air used to be the war-fighting domains; now, space is one of those domains as well. It means that we've had to increase the cybersecurity posture of our spacecraft constantly and invest in resilience. We operate them civilly, but we are under no illusion that they are under constant threat so we watch that very carefully.

With the rest of the world, we are trying to make sure that there are rules and norms of conduct in space that everyone follows so that we don't make it even more dangerous. Space is hard enough. It's lethal for humans, and debris poses a serious problem. We're trying to keep it safe for everyone.

My first question is with regard to the International Space Station. Yes, billions of Canadian tax dollars have been put into the International Space Station. I still remember being a young lad when the pieces were being launched up in the late 1990s, and mankind started to orbit in the International Space Station in the year 2000, as it continued to be built.

The reason I bring it up is my concern for the planned de-orbit of the International Space Station as of 2031. I was wondering what the CSA's position is on that. Has there been any discussion to extend the usage of the International Space Station beyond 2031?

Thank you.

4:35 p.m.

President, Canadian Space Agency

Lisa Campbell

Thank you for the question. It's a live one for all of us in the space community. It is humanity's precious microgravity laboratory, but it's getting older. There's a leak in the Russian module, and our Canadarm is constantly doing repairs. We've put out solar arrays to keep fuel and power going, but with the stress and orbital mechanics on it, at some point, it will have to de-orbit.

The United States had plans for commercial space stations. Those have evolved a lot, partly as companies realized how difficult and how expensive it would be. There are a few companies that will launch much smaller modules, but for the moment, the only alternative is China's small space station in low-earth orbit. It's about a third of the size of the ISS. Other countries, like India, and Europe are talking about having a low-earth-orbit space station.

We're very worried about the loss of all of that expertise if that stopped. We are very hopeful for some form of continuity to keep the ISS going as long as possible, because it's so precious. It teaches us so much. We're in active discussions with partners around the world. What can we do to make sure that there's some form of public platform for space science and for astronauts to go to? We learn so much from it and from keeping a continuous human presence going, as you mentioned, for 25 years.

We want to keep that going, but right now it's not obvious what the successors will be. It would be a big leap, if that stopped, to go from there to deep space. You'd want to keep that know-how and muscle memory going as long as possible.

It's also very beneficial to our companies. We launch science experiments from there so that they have access to space science.

To follow up on that concern with regard to the International Space Station, what is CSA's official position? Is it to prolong it or to de-orbit it in 2031?

4:40 p.m.

President, Canadian Space Agency

Lisa Campbell

The Canadian Space Agency received additional funding to participate up until 2030, and we're very grateful for it.

At some point, with spacecraft.... As you heard my colleague mention, we've kept some of our satellites for 23 years. We have a mission life of five years, but we keep them for much longer, which we're very proud of. That might sound responsible in terms of a return on investment. The only issue is, increasingly, we need to plan for de-orbit and save enough fuel so that we can do a controlled re-entry, just as we saw with Artemis II. Their re-entry was controlled. They reached 3,000°C as plasma burned up around them, and there were parachutes.

It's the same thing with the International Space Station. We have to make sure that there's enough control over the International Space Station to be able to de-orbit it responsibly. You may have seen some of the issues with space debris lately, so a controlled re-entry is the most important thing.

Will the structure last that long? I mentioned the persistent leak in the Russian module. That's a problem. We're doing what we can to maintain it. Will other issues arise as the structure ages? We hope not. We're doing preventative maintenance, but it is already reaching beyond what we anticipated when we first launched it.

Are you aware of any third alternative solution, not just an international space station and not de-orbiting it in 2031? Has private enterprise inquired with the CSA, NASA or any other international space agency to keep the ISS up there in space?

4:40 p.m.

President, Canadian Space Agency

Lisa Campbell

I remember, since 2020, commercial organizations have been active in either using a portion of the International Space Station to create something else or launching their own space stations. There have been a number of proposals. None of them have gotten very far. We may see some changes this year with much smaller modules launched, but not a full station.

We haven't seen the idea of creating something like the International Space Station at that size yet. It's been on a much smaller scale. Often, where they have difficulty is with the business plan. Who will the market be? Is it government? Is there a private market for this? At the moment, it's still very expensive, so they seem to be wrestling with that. India has spoken about launching its own space station and welcoming international partners. Europe has spoken of that as well, but it is a complex endeavour.

NASA has said that they are planning crewed missions to the moon again. I don't necessarily mean committing astronauts, but is the CSA participating in the development of these missions to land crews on the moon?

4:40 p.m.

President, Canadian Space Agency

Lisa Campbell

We are part of something called the Artemis Accords, which is a political agreement among 66 countries for deep space. Canada is one of the first countries. We also hosted the second workshop on the Artemis Accords, and now 66 countries are planning for a permanent presence on the moon.

The moon is a challenging environment. There's a dust called regolith that gets in absolutely everything. It can be -200°C or 100°C. There's planning for the batteries and trying to survive a lunar night, which can be 14 days at -200°C. Canadians are pretty good at that, but the moon is a whole different story.

It's an unforgiving environment. There's also really rough terrain. We're constructing vehicles that can go down into canyons and not tip over. Then there is actually achieving a lunar landing. There have been some commercial entities that have tried, and some of them have crashed into the moon. Slowing down enough so that you can do a soft landing on the moon is very challenging.

Yes, Canada is very much part of that. We're sought after for our robotics. We've been investing for years in surface mobility, so we're ready for this now. We've engaged with three companies for the mission concept and five companies for the science we would do on the moon. NASA is very much looking for international partners, not only because they want it to be an international endeavour but also, quite frankly, for financial reasons. They need the contributions of other countries.

Further to that, once we're actually there, is there a plan for what kind of research is going to be done on the moon? What are the possible scientific and industrial potentials of such research?

4:45 p.m.

President, Canadian Space Agency

Lisa Campbell

We're all very interested in the south pole of the moon because we think there's water ice there, which we could use to live and also convert to hydrogen to go further into the solar system—to Mars and beyond.

Geology was mentioned earlier. The moon used to be part of earth. We can learn a lot about earth from studying the moon. You might have heard, if you listened to the Artemis II crew, that they saw parts of the moon that human eyes have never seen. They saw micrometeorites hitting it. There is a tremendous amount of science.

There are also resources. There are companies and countries that are very interested in the resources on the moon. We're doing our very best to make sure that it's a collaborative endeavour with interoperability. That will be important.

The Université de Sherbrooke is working on a major project: a small, astromobile vehicle. However, the mission was cancelled. It was to be part of the first of three planned launches, the second with Canadarm3 and the third with the lunar utility vehicle.

Isn't it unfortunate that after all of Canada's efforts and investments at this stage, funding was withdrawn? You said we should go and explore the lunar south pole region. Will Canada lose some of its leadership at the international level?

4:45 p.m.

President, Canadian Space Agency

Lisa Campbell

It's always sad when you have to make difficult decisions such as stopping or not continuing a project.

However, we're very aware this is taxpayers' money and that it must be used responsibly. As I said earlier, we were asked to find $41.3 million in savings. We did that by stopping this project, since there were signs it would be difficult to complete on schedule and within the budget. Given that and the request to reduce the budget, we did what had to be done.

That said, scientific development will go on. As I said earlier, there are some great companies in Sherbrooke doing extraordinary scientific development. I'm thinking in particular of SBQuantum, which uses the earth's magnetosphere to create very specific maps. It's extraordinary.
